Today I rise in strong support of the Tarmac Carper Water Resource Development act of 2024. My district, the third congressional district of the state of Wisconsin, has the largest contiguous section in the Mississippi river of any congressional district in the nation. We don't have a north or south highway. We've got the Mississippi River. And while there's unparalleled economic, transportation and recreational significance of a region, our communities along the river are subject to flooding due to weather events and aging infrastructure.
